Japan Augmented Reality Solutions Market: Sector Dynamics and Growth Drivers

The Japanese AR solutions sector is characterized by a mature yet highly innovative environment, with a strategic focus on industrial and enterprise applications. The market’s growth is propelled by Japan’s technological prowess, government initiatives promoting digital transformation, and corporate investments in AR-enabled workflows. The integration of AR with artificial intelligence, machine learning, and IoT is creating a new wave of intelligent solutions that enhance operational efficiency and customer engagement. Additionally, Japan’s aging population and labor shortages are accelerating adoption in sectors like healthcare and manufacturing, where AR offers training, remote assistance, and automation support.

Market maturity is evident through the presence of established players and a robust startup ecosystem. The sector’s evolution is driven by increasing demand for immersive training, remote collaboration, and innovative retail experiences. As AR hardware becomes more affordable and lightweight, adoption barriers are decreasing, fostering broader deployment across diverse industries. The long-term outlook remains optimistic, with sustained investments in R&D and strategic partnerships expected to catalyze further market expansion. The Japanese government’s focus on Industry 4.0 and smart manufacturing underscores the sector’s strategic importance and growth potential.

Japan Augmented Reality Solutions Market: Regulatory Environment and Policy Impact

The regulatory landscape in Japan significantly influences the deployment and development of AR solutions. The government’s proactive stance on digital innovation, Industry 4.0, and smart manufacturing fosters a conducive environment for AR adoption. Policies promoting data privacy, cybersecurity, and intellectual property rights are aligned with international standards, ensuring a secure ecosystem for AR applications. Additionally, Japan’s strategic initiatives, such as the Society 5.0 vision, emphasize integrating AR into societal infrastructure, healthcare, and urban development, further incentivizing industry players.

Regulatory frameworks are evolving to address emerging challenges related to data security, user safety, and device interoperability. The Japanese government offers grants and subsidies for R&D projects focused on AR, encouraging innovation and commercialization. Compliance with local standards is crucial for market entry, especially for hardware manufacturers. The policy environment’s stability and forward-looking approach provide a strategic advantage for companies willing to invest in long-term AR solutions. As regulations mature, they will likely catalyze higher standards of quality and security, fostering consumer trust and broader adoption.

Japan Augmented Reality Solutions Market: Technological Trends and Innovation Trajectories

Technological innovation is the backbone of Japan’s AR solutions market, with continuous advancements in hardware, software, and integration capabilities. The proliferation of lightweight AR glasses and headsets, combined with high-resolution displays and spatial mapping, enhances user experience and operational efficiency. AI integration enables context-aware AR applications, providing real-time insights and automation support. Moreover, 5G connectivity accelerates data transfer speeds, reducing latency and enabling seamless remote collaboration and training scenarios.

Emerging trends include the development of AR cloud platforms for persistent and shared experiences, and the use of computer vision for enhanced object recognition and interaction. Startups and established firms are investing heavily in R&D to push the boundaries of AR realism, interactivity, and usability. The convergence of AR with other emerging technologies like blockchain and edge computing opens new avenues for secure, decentralized, and scalable solutions. As technological barriers diminish and standards evolve, Japan’s AR ecosystem is poised for exponential growth, driven by innovation and strategic industry collaborations.
